Core Simulations
7Doppler Effect
Interactive simulation of the Doppler Effect — visualizes how the frequency of sound waves shifts with relative motion between source and observer.
Optics Lab
Web-based geometric optics simulation. Supports ray sources, parallel and divergent beams, mirrors, lenses, beam splitters, and refraction interfaces.
Oscillations And Chaos
Collection of four classical mechanics simulations exploring oscillations and chaos: single spring, double spring, pendulum, and double pendulum.
Qubit Sketch
Drag-and-drop quantum circuit builder with a live state simulator. Place quantum gates and watch probabilities, amplitudes, Bloch spheres, and measurements update in real time.
Resonance
Interactive simulation of resonance in driven oscillating systems. Visualizes driven mass-spring systems and Chladni plate patterns.
Track Lab
Browser-based video motion-analysis tool. Load a video, calibrate real-world distances, and auto-track objects across frames using computer vision.
Wave Composer
Three-screen VoceVista-style real-time voice-analysis simulation. Analyzes microphone input for waveform, spectrum, and composition.
Classic & PhET Ports
6Electric Field Of Dreams
SceneryStack port of the PhET 'Electric Field of Dreams' simulation. Place charged particles and observe Coulomb interactions and an adjustable uniform external field.
Lady Bug
SceneryStack port of the PhET 'Ladybug Motion 2D' simulation. Explore 2D motion, position, velocity, and acceleration using a ladybug on a rotating platform.
Lunar Lander
SceneryStack port of the classic PhET Flash 'Lunar Lander' simulation. Pilot a lunar module to a soft landing by managing thrust and tilt against gravity.
Maze Game
SceneryStack port of the PhET 'Maze Game' simulation. Drive a particle through tile-based mazes using position, velocity, or acceleration control modes.
Moving Man
SceneryStack port of the PhET Java 'Moving Man' simulation. Explore 1D kinematics by dragging a man or using position/velocity/acceleration sliders.
Radio Waves
SceneryStack port of the PhET 'Radio Waves & Electromagnetic Fields' simulation, rebuilt from the legacy PIXI.js + Backbone version. Wiggle an electron and watch EM radiation propagate.
